Transaction 2950fa4fbce204d3731065c73e1140c0d23076c5ac04527d8111d012ef338437

1 Input
2 Outputs
  • 2950fa4fbce204d3731065c73e1140c0d23076c5ac04527d8111d012ef338437:0
  • value  50339464
    address  1CbThXLPkK7D1bxwtDwQuVVBQULvQVHTRS
  • 2950fa4fbce204d3731065c73e1140c0d23076c5ac04527d8111d012ef338437:1
  • value  763718
    address  39jRNysEu1NKUB85qCvZiaqZS3auGfrSGm